City Asset in S. Jakarta Protected With Signpost

In order to protect the assets of Jakarta Provincial Government, around four plots of land in Grogol Utara Urban Village, Kebayoran Lama Sub-District mounted a signpost of ownership.

Mayor of South Jakarta, Tri Kurniadi disclosed, the ownership signpost was mounted in order to anticipate takeover action from third party. The land is the obligation of the developer to the city's public facilities (SUK).

"This is obligation matter from PT Permata Hijau developer that already delivered in 1996. Then for its designation is for park, educational facility and others. That's why we keep this by mounting a signpost," he told, Thursday (2/4).

Those four plots are located at Jalan Alexandria, Permata Hijau Housing Complex as wide as 3,000 square meters, Block J as wide as 3,000 square meters, Block D as wide as 1,000 square meters, as well as Jalan Emas and Jalan Perak.

He added South Jakarta Administration will charge developers who have not submitted their obligations to the city administration.

"Yesterday, we already mounted a signpost in Petukangan. We will keep hunting the developers," he asserted.
